wCMF Orange 2.5 Released
Sunday, November 18th, 2007The 2.5 version of our MDA framework for PHP has been released.
You can download it from the SourceForge site.
From this version we support the Web 2.0 within a Model Driven Architecture paradigm.
The most important enhancements are:
a new generation strategy that separates the generated classes completely from the custom ones

wCMF 1.1 released
Friday, September 16th, 2005The 1.1 release of wCMF is available for download.
While still mostly being used for building CMS, wCMF is generally speaking a versatile web application framework based on the MVC pattern. A first non CMS project (in the e-commerce field) did now proof wCMF’s capabilities for fast and flexible application development.
